Ergonomic Features That Improve Office table Comfort

Ergonomics plays a vital role in determining how effective an Office table can be in supporting daily work routines. Poor posture and uncomfortable setups often lead to fatigue, reduced concentration, and long-term physical issues, which is why ergonomic design has become a key requirement. An ideal Office table should be designed at a height that supports natural arm positioning, allowing users to type and write without strain. Adequate legroom, rounded edges, and adjustable configurations further enhance comfort. Many modern workplaces now integrate sit-stand options that allow users to alternate between sitting and standing positions, improving circulation and reducing stiffness. Cable management features also contribute to a more organized setup, preventing tangled wires and clutter. When the Office table is ergonomically optimized, it directly contributes to better productivity and reduced health risks, making it an essential investment for both employees and businesses aiming to maintain high performance levels.

Material Strength and Long Term Value of Office table

The durability of an Office table depends largely on the material used in its construction. Different materials offer different advantages depending on the environment and usage requirements. Wooden tables provide a premium look and are often used in executive offices, while engineered wood offers a cost-effective balance between durability and style. Metal-framed tables are highly durable and suitable for high-usage environments where strength is a priority. Laminated surfaces are also widely used due to their resistance to scratches and ease of cleaning. A strong Office table should maintain its structure even after years of continuous use, making material selection an important decision. Resistance to moisture, heat, and daily wear ensures that the table remains functional and visually appealing over time. Investing in high-quality materials not only enhances performance but also reduces maintenance costs, making it a practical long-term choice for any workspace setup.

Maintenance Practices for Durable Office table Performance

Regular maintenance is essential to preserve the functionality and appearance of an Office table over time. Simple cleaning routines help prevent dust buildup and maintain a professional look. Using appropriate cleaning products ensures that the surface remains undamaged while keeping it hygienic. It is also important to avoid placing excessive weight on the table to maintain structural integrity. Periodic checks of joints, screws, and support frames help detect early signs of wear and prevent potential damage. For wooden surfaces, occasional polishing enhances durability and maintains shine, while metal frames should be inspected for rust prevention. Protective accessories like desk mats and pads further help in reducing scratches and surface damage. Proper maintenance not only extends the lifespan of the Office table but also ensures a consistently clean and efficient workspace environment.
